Myanmar Junta Eyes Russian Investment in Tanintharyi


The junta’s energy minister Ko Ko Lwin and his Russian counterparts have discussed the construction of a liquefied natural gas (LNG) terminal near Dawei deep-sea port in southern Myanmar.


He met Russian energy deputy chief Pavel Sorokin and international relations head Alexander Boldyrev at the state-owned Zarubezhneft oil firm in Moscow on Thursday to follow up on an agreement reached between junta boss Min Aung Hlaing and Russian President Vladimir Putin.
